The collection of trace evidence has always proven to be a challenge. Web27 dec. 2024 · 1300s Through Mid-1800s. Over the next 500 years, advancements in crime scene investigation focused on the many aspects of fingerprint detail and chemical elements like poisons. In 1813, Mathieu Bonaventure Orfila, who is considered the father of modern toxicology, published "Traite des Poisons," and in the mid-1800s, investigators at …
